Ingredients for Crispy Baked Chicken Tenders:
To create deliciously crispy baked chicken tenders, gather the following ingredients:
- Panko Breadcrumbs: 1 1/2 cups
- Oil Spray: Essential for toasting and baking
For the Chicken Batter
- Egg: 1 large
- Mayonnaise: 1 tbsp
- Dijon Mustard: 1 1/2 tbsp (or your choice of mustard)
- Flour: 2 tbsp
- Salt: 1/2 tsp
- Black Pepper: To taste
Chicken Components
- Chicken Tenderloins: 500 g (1 lb) or chicken breast, sliced into 2/3″ (1.5 cm) thick strips
- Oil Spray: For a crispy finish

How to Prepare Crispy Baked Chicken Tenders:
For irresistibly crunchy and flavorful Crispy Baked Chicken Tenders, start by preheating your oven to 200°C (390°F). Spread 1.5 cups of panko breadcrumbs on a baking tray and spray with oil. Toast them in the oven for 3 to 5 minutes until they turn light golden. Meanwhile, create a tasty batter by whisking together an egg, 1 tbsp mayonnaise, 1.5 tbsp Dijon mustard, 2 tbsp flour, salt, and black pepper in a bowl.
Next, coat 1 pound of chicken tenderloins in the batter. Then, using tongs, transfer the chicken to the bowl of toasted panko, ensuring they are well crumbed. Press down to maintain adherence, and place them on a baking tray. Lightly spray the chicken with oil and bake for 15 to 20 minutes, depending on size. Storage Tips for Crispy Baked Chicken Tenders:
To keep your Crispy Baked Chicken Tenders fresh and flavorful, proper storage is essential. First, allow the tenders to cool completely after baking. If they are stored while still warm, they may become soggy. Once cooled, place them in an airtight container or wrap them tightly in plastic wrap. You can refrigerate them for up to three days. For longer storage, consider freezing the tenders. Spread them out on a baking sheet first, freeze until solid, then transfer to a freezer-safe bag or container. This way, they won’t stick together. To reheat, use an oven for the best crispiness. Simply preheat to 375°F (190°C) and bake for 10-15 minutes. How do I ensure my chicken tenders stay crispy?
To achieve perfectly crispy chicken tenders, first, ensure they are well-coated with breadcrumbs. Next, using a wire rack on a baking sheet allows hot air to circulate around the chicken, preventing sogginess. Additionally, for extra crunch, consider a light spray of cooking oil before baking.

Ingredients
1 1/2 cups panko breadcrumbs
Oil spray
1 egg
1 tbsp mayonnaise
1 1/2 tbsp dijon mustard
2 tbsp flour
1/2 tsp salt
Black pepper
500 g chicken tenderloins
Oil spray
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 200°C/390°F (180° fan-forced).
- Spread panko on a baking tray, spray with oil, then bake for 3 to 5 minutes until light golden. Transfer to bowl.
- Place a rack on a baking tray.
- In a bowl, whisk together the Batter ingredients. Add the chicken and toss to coat.
- Using tongs, place the chicken into the panko bowl, sprinkle with breadcrumbs, then press down to adhere.
- Transfer to baking tray and lightly spray with oil, then sprinkle with salt if desired.
- Bake for 15 to 20 minutes, or until cooked through, avoiding overcooking.
- Serve immediately with a sauce of choice and sprinkle with fresh parsley if desired.
Notes
Panko breadcrumbs create a superior crunch. You can prep the breadcrumb and batter ahead but crumb the chicken just before baking for best results.
